Σκληρός δίσκος που έδινε το ConnX δεν αναγνωρίζεται ενώ φαίνεται να παίρνει ρεύμα
Manolis Kiagias
sonicy at otenet.gr
Fri Apr 11 09:17:25 BST 2008
Stathis wrote:
> O/H Manolis Kiagias έγραψε:
>>
>>
>> Stathis wrote:
>>>>>>
>>>>> Λοιπόν, έβαλα ένα εσωτερικό δίσκο 10GB και μπήκε ως sdb ενώ ο είδε
>>>>> το εξωτερικό ως sdc.
>>>>> Έκανα με το gparted τον εσωτερικό sdb ως extended (δεν κατάλαβα αν
>>>>> έπρεπε να το κάνω πρωτεύον).
>>>>> Και τον εξωτερικό δίσκο τον έκανα fat32 και πρωτεύον.
>>>>>
>>>>> Δεν κατάλαβα τώρα. Πρέπει να κάνω επανεκκίνηση για να τους δεί
>>>>> (βασικά τον εσωτερικό).
>>>>>
>>>> Τον εσωτερικό, τι filesystem του έβαλες; Θα σε συμβούλευα να βάλεις
>>>> ext3 και σε πρωτεύον. Αν πας στο Places / Computer θα πρέπει μάλλον
>>>> να τον βλέπεις μετά. Για να τον χρησιμοποιήσεις σωστά, πιθανόν θα
>>>> θες να τον κάνεις mount σε κάποιο σημείο, φτιάχνοντας την
>>>> αντίστοιχη καταχώρηση στο fstab.
>>>>
>>> Το έκανα τελικά πρωτεύον σε ext3. Στο Τοποθεσίες/Υπολογιστής δεν το
>>> βρήκε.
>>> Πως μπορώ να κάνω την mount καταχώρηση στο fastab? Είμαι κάπως
>>> αρχάριος και δεν έχω κάνει κάτι τέτοιο.
>>>
>>>
>> Αρχικά θα κάνεις μια δοκιμή να δεις αν πράγματι μπορεί να γίνει
>> κανονικά mount. Αυτό μπορεί να γίνει κάπως έτσι:
>>
>> sudo mount /dev/sdb1 /mnt
>>
>> Με τον τρόπο αυτό θα τον προσαρτήσεις στο /mnt (προσωρινά)
>>
>> Αν δεν πάρεις μήνυμα λάθους, δώσε την εντολή mount χωρίς καμιά
>> παράμετρο. Θα δεις μέσα στις γραμμές και κάτι σαν αυτό:
>>
>> /dev/sdb1 on /mnt type ext3 (rw)
>>
>> Αν αυτό λειτουργεί, δώσε:
>>
>> sudo umount /mnt
>>
>> Φτιάξε ένα κατάλογο για να τον κάνεις μόνιμη προσάρτηση, π.χ.:
>>
>> sudo mkdir /data
>>
>> Και άνοιξε το αρχείο /etc/fstab με κάποιο editor, π.χ.
>>
>> sudo gedit /etc/fstab
>>
>> Πρόσθεσε στο τέλος τη γραμμή:
>>
>> /dev/sdb1 /data ext3 defaults 0 2
>>
>> Αποθήκευσε.
>>
>> Δώσε τώρα sudo mount /data
>>
>> Αν δεν δεις μήνυμα λάθους επαλήθευσε δίνοντας πάλι απλώς
>>
>> mount
>>
>> Θα δεις και την γραμμή:
>>
>> /dev/sdb1 on /data type ext3 (rw)
>>
>> Τέλος, για να μπορείς να γράφεις στο δίσκο που προσάρτησες, δώσε τα
>> απαραίτητα δικαιώματα στον εαυτό σου:
>> (Στο παράδειγμα βάλε όπου myser το όνομα χρήστη σου):
>>
>> sudo chown -R myuser /data
>> sudo chmod -R u+rwx /data
>>
>> Είσαι έτοιμος, και ο δίσκος σε κάθε επανεκκίνηση θα προσαρτάται στο
>> /data
>>
>>
>>
>>
>
> Ευχαριστώ πολύ. Έχει γίνει όπως το είπατε.
> Θα ήθελα επιπλέον να ρωτήσω και για να τον κάνω τσεκ για λάθη κλπ. Το
> fsck κάνει; Πρέπει να μπώ ως su και να το τρέξω; Επειδή ο δίσκος είναι
> κάπως παλιός και μάλλον έχω ξεσυνιθίσει στον θόρυβό του, δεν ξέρω αν
> είναι ΟΚ (είναι και western digital που φοβάμαι πάρα πολύ).
>
>
Ναι, το fsck κάνει. Ωστόσο θα πρέπει πρώτα να τον κάνεις unmount.
Παράδειγμα:
sudo umount /data
sudo /sbin/fsck.ext3 /dev/sdb1 (ή και sudo /sbin/e2fsck /dev/sdb1)
sudo mount /data
Επίσης το σύστημα θα τον κάνει fsck αυτόματα -αν χρειάζεται- βλέποντας
το 2 (pass) στο fstab. Γενικά το ext3 δεν χρειάζεται συχνά πλήρες check,
λόγω του journaling. Επανέρχεται πολύ γρήγορα σε σταθερή κατάσταση. Tο
ίδιο το σύστημα κάνει πλήρες fsck μετά από κάποιες επανεκκινήσεις
(μετράει πόσες φορές έχει γίνει mount χωρίς να έχει γίνει check, κάτι το
οποίο ρυθμίζεται με το tune2fs. Νομίζω το default είναι να γίνεται check
κάθε 31 mounts).
Από την άλλη, αν έχεις υποψίες για bad sectors, θα σε συμβούλευα, άσχετα
με το fsck, να μην τον χρησιμοποιήσεις για τίποτα κρίσιμο. Οι 10άρηδες
WD δεν θυμάμαι να είχαν προβλήματα αξιοπιστίας πάντως, αν και φυσικά
είναι αρκετά πιο θορυβώδεις από καινούριους δίσκους.
More information about the Ubuntu-gr
mailing list